Trump shrinks Utah monuments, unlocking land for energy projects

TL;DR Summary
President Trump signed an executive order that reduces Grand Staircase-Escalante and Bears Ears monuments in Utah by about 90% (from roughly 3 million acres to 300,000), aiming to open land to energy development. Utah Governor Spencer Cox praised the move as aligning with the Antiquities Act, while Native groups criticized it for erasing cultural sites. The sites were designated as monuments by Clinton in 1996 and Obama in 2016.
